Output 518244f89e2afce01b211b74fefb296047d4d42233da4a20e2a66fde0d867510:2

value
116353
script pubkey
OP_0 OP_PUSHBYTES_20 c1cb2954d71e0be7b4d3f97ceb8969b8695a2fb9
address
bc1qc89jj4xhrc970dxnl97whztfhp545taeyup8z5
transaction
518244f89e2afce01b211b74fefb296047d4d42233da4a20e2a66fde0d867510
confirmations
55476
spent
true